Описание

В приложении существуют 3 агента по расписанию: ScheduleCreateData, ScheduleDeteteData, ScheduleDeleteSettings.

Изначально все агенты подписаны пользователем Developers Team/Apps4Notes. Подпишите их учетной записью Вашей организации перед началом работы.

Включение агента может быть выполнено при создании реплик приложения в мастере установки приложения, который вызывается при первом запуске или при нажатии Приложение \ Сконфигурировать в представлении Настройка ( Администрирование ). Для включения или выключения, подписания и установки сервера запуска агента в любое время выполните:

Откройте представление Настройки;
В меню выберите Агенты \ Включить ( Выключить ) AgentName, где AgentName - имя агента по расписанию.

Текущий статус агента доступен для просмотра в Документе настроек Приложения ( закладка Агенты ) с именем агента.


Агент ScheduleCreateData

Агент требуется для построения отчетов по расписанию на сервере. Кроме формирования данных отчета на сервере агент может выполнять экспорт созданных данных отчета в файл и отправку его по электронной почте.

Агент должен выполняться в Реплике Данных. Параметры запуска: каждый час целые сутки.

Перед началом работы подпишите агент учетной записью с достаточным уровнем доступа на чтение документов в базах данных, используемых как источники данных для отчетов.

Кроме того, если предполагается экспорт данных отчетов в файл на сервере после его формирования, установите достаточный уровень выполнения операций пользователю, подписавшему агент, прописав его в документе сервера на закладке Security в поле Run unrestricted methods and operations.

Только пользователи с установленной ролью SetSchedule в ACL смогут устанавливать расписание и создавать данные отчетов по расписанию на сервере.


Агент ScheduleDeleteData

Агент требуется для удаления данных отчетов, созданных по расписанию на сервере.

Агент должен выполняться в Реплике Данных. Параметры запуска: ежедневно, время 00:00.

Посмотреть текущий статус агента и установить параметры удаления документов Вы можете в Документе настроек Приложения ( закладка Агенты ) с именем ScheduleDeleteData.


Агент ScheduleDeleteSettings

Агент требуется для удаления любых документов в приложении, кроме данных отчетов. В приложении выполняется отложенное удаление документов на сервере. Когда пользователь удаляет документы в Локальной Реплике, они только помечаются для удаления ( поле Deleted = "1" ) и, после репликации, действительно удаляются на сервере агентом.

Агент должен выполняться в Реплике Настроек. Параметры запуска: ежедневно, время 00:00.

Посмотреть текущий статус агента и установить параметры удаления документов Вы можете в Документе настроек Приложения ( закладка Агенты ) с именем ScheduleDeleteSettings.


Ссылки по теме:

Документ настроек Приложения

Реплики приложения

Смотрите также:

Установка приложения